Howard County sits between Baltimore and Washington, D.C. This county has a bit of everything. It’s not huge, but the schools here are top-notch.

Columbia is the county’s biggest town. It was built from scratch in the 1960s with the idea of being the perfect suburb. Turns out, they weren’t far off.

From farm-to-table joints to international cuisine, Howard County’s got you covered. And if you’re into history, you can’t miss the B&O Railroad Museum in Ellicott City. It’s a real trip back in time.

CategoryDetails
County NameHoward County
County SeatEllicott City
Population340,000
Cities, Towns, and CommunitiesEllicott City, Columbia, Laurel, Savage, and several unincorporated communities
Interstates and HighwaysInterstate 95, U.S. Route 29, Maryland Route 32, Maryland Route 108
FIPS Code24-027
Total Area (Land and Water)253.6 square miles (land: 250.1 sq mi, water: 3.5 sq mi)
Adjacent Counties (and Direction)Anne Arundel County (Southeast), Baltimore County (Northeast), Carroll County (North), Montgomery County (Southwest), Prince George’s County (South)
Time ZoneEastern Time Zone (EST)
StateMaryland
Coordinates39.22°N, 76.85°W
EtymologyNamed after John Eager Howard, an American Revolutionary War officer and governor of Maryland
Major LandmarksHoward County Historical Society, Ellicott City Historic District, Robinson Nature Center, Columbia Mall
